LoginSignup

This article is a Private article. Only a writer and users who know the URL can access it.
Please change open range to public in publish setting if you want to share this article with other users.

More than 1 year has passed since last update.

【設計】【短期】Qiitaの今読んでおくべき記事100選【毎週自動更新】

Last updated at Posted at 2020-04-09

ページ容量を増やさないために、不具合報告やコメントは、説明記事 に記載いただけると助かります。

順位 記事名
________________________________________
ユーザ 投稿日付
更新日付
LGTM1
1 要件定義~システム設計ができる人材になれる記事 Saku731 20/01/11
21/07/06
4351
195
2 実装クリーンアーキテクチャ nrslib 18/09/29
20/12/13
2508
147
3 翻訳: WebAPI 設計のベストプラクティス mserizawa 16/03/23
17/12/17
5448
131
4 スケールする要求を支える仕様の「意図」と「直交性」 hirokidaichi 21/07/05
21/07/15
789
789
5 やはりお前たちのRepositoryは間違っている mikesorae 18/05/18
21/02/11
1655
107
6 個人開発・スタートアップで採用すべき最強のアーキテクチャを考えた yuno_miyako 20/10/28
20/10/30
1931
57
7 「ビジネスロジック」とは何か、どう実装するのか os1ma 20/06/27
21/05/23
1415
120
8 設計を学びたいときに読みたい本一覧 getty104 21/07/02
21/07/18
446
446
9 技術選定/アーキテクチャ設計で後悔しないためのガイドライン hirokidaichi 20/12/15
21/07/07
1553
80
10 単一責任原則で無責任な多目的クラスを爆殺する MinoDriven 20/12/08
20/12/09
1555
49
11 排他制御(楽観ロック・悲観ロック)の基礎  NagaokaKenichi 18/04/08
18/04/08
810
63
12 PlantUML Cheat Sheet ogomr 14/09/22
19/10/23
2367
36
13 ドキュメント作成スキル向上を目指す人向けおすすめ記事まとめ yasuoyasuo 20/04/07
21/04/16
1637
41
14 Visual Studio Code で UML を描こう! couzie 17/04/08
17/04/08
1119
51
15 関心の分離を意識した名前設計で巨大クラスを爆殺する MinoDriven 19/10/21
20/12/07
1875
35
16 AmazonのAPI設計方針 (The Bezos Mandate) shimataro999 19/12/15
19/12/15
174
128
17 Clean ArchitectureでAPI Serverを構築してみる hirotakan 16/12/10
19/10/09
857
60
18 ドメイン駆動設計は何を解決しようとしているのか[DDD] little_hand_s 18/10/08
20/02/17
581
57
19 エンジニア歴20数年の私が、設計書を書く際に心がけていること y-some 18/02/12
19/10/30
2074
27
20 お前らがModelと呼ぶアレをなんと呼ぶべきか。近辺の用語(EntityとかVOとかDTOとか)について整理しつつ考える takasek 17/12/12
17/12/14
1309
45
21 GoFのデザインパターンまとめ i-tanaka730 19/03/28
21/01/22
393
60
22 Excel設計書を抹殺したくて4年前にWiki設計書を導入したら、意外とちゃんと開発回ってた話。 gakuri 20/02/23
20/02/24
1723
28
23 C++でクリーンなコードの書き方 elipmoc101 18/12/13
21/04/13
514
57
24 【要件定義】いきなり内容説明しない!業務フローを説明するまでの「長い道のり」をまとめました。 aki_number16 21/05/11
21/05/14
305
305
25 「実践ドメイン駆動設計」を読んだので、実際にDDDで設計して作ってみた! APPLE4869 18/12/17
20/01/16
905
27
26 設計要件をギッチギチに詰めたValueObjectで低凝集クラスを爆殺する MinoDriven 19/11/04
19/11/10
1019
13
27 Webアプリケーションフレームワーク導入時に考慮すべき22の観点 tmknom 17/12/16
20/03/25
2055
25
28 クラスの命名のアンチパターン magicant 14/09/04
16/06/22
2679
33
29 結局UMLとかシーケンス図とかAWSの図とかどれで描くと良いのよ?と思ったときの選択肢 e99h2121 21/04/18
21/05/15
314
72
30 MVC、3 層アーキテクチャから設計を学び始めるための基礎知識 os1ma 19/06/20
21/05/23
261
53
31 「トランザクション」とは何か?を超わかりやすく語ってみた! zd6ir7 18/01/10
19/04/20
437
17
32 PlantUML使い方メモ opengl-8080 20/04/26
20/04/26
273
38
33 [DDD]ドメイン駆動 + オニオンアーキテクチャ概略 little_hand_s 17/10/10
20/02/17
639
21
34 変更に強いアーキテクチャについてIT業界19年目の僕が超ザックリ説明する lobin-z0x50 18/12/06
20/04/08
1034
41
35 5歳娘「パパ、変なAPIを作らないで?」 Yametaro 20/07/20
20/07/29
1381
7
36 [DDD]ドメイン駆動設計で実装を始めるのに一番とっつきやすいアーキテクチャは何か little_hand_s 17/10/04
20/02/17
632
19
37 オブジェクト指向プログラミングとドメイン駆動設計を学ぶのに適切な書籍とおすすめの読む順番 yushi_koga 21/04/18
21/04/18
308
55
38 役割駆動設計で巨大クラスを爆殺する MinoDriven 19/04/07
20/12/07
1485
13
39 よく聞くUMLって何? taku_maru 17/06/15
17/06/18
396
30
40 システム設計の流れ・設計書の構成メモ chocode 18/04/26
19/05/09
512
23
41 『Microservice Patterns』 まとめ yasuabe2613 18/12/07
20/03/18
411
25
42 Nginxのアーキテクチャを理解する kamihork 19/03/05
20/06/13
259
27
43 ネットワーク図・システム構成図作成に使えるアイコン集 Ping 16/11/30
21/05/11
557
15
44 さいきょうの二重サブミット対策 syobochim 15/12/22
15/12/23
1221
17
45 宣言的UIはReact Hooksで完成に至り、現代的設計論が必須の時代になる erukiti 19/09/06
19/09/29
661
13
46 なぜ、組織のつくりとソフトウェアアーキテクチャは似てしまうのか hirokidaichi 18/12/25
21/07/05
969
13
47 書籍「マイクロサービスアーキテクチャ」まとめ(前編) crossroad0201 16/10/05
19/06/13
529
14
48 WebAPI でファイルをアップロードする方法アレコレ mserizawa 17/01/23
17/01/24
479
20
49 レビューする人も、される人も知っておきたい!開発プロセスごとのレビュー観点チェックリスト vankobe 20/12/01
20/12/06
382
9
50 Vue3 Composition APIにおいて、Providerパターン(provide/inject)の使い方と、なぜ重要なのか、理解する。 karamage 20/07/17
20/07/24
164
39
51 仕様書の書き方 ko1 15/05/15
16/04/20
961
17
52 [API] API仕様書の書き方 sunstripe2011 16/06/09
20/12/01
458
15
53 Unityにおける「設計レベル」を定義してみた toRisouP 21/02/23
21/02/24
273
17
54 「WebAPI 設計のベストプラクティス」に対する所感 ryo88c 16/03/28
17/04/07
1026
29
55 ソフトウェア設計・アーキテクチャの学び方 ROPITAL 21/06/22
21/06/22
112
112
56 Webサービスによくある各機能の仕様とセキュリティ観点(ユーザ登録機能) shioshiota 20/05/16
20/05/17
875
7
57 Laravelでドメイン駆動設計(DDD)を実践し、Eloquent Model依存の設計から脱却する mejileben 19/12/09
20/12/19
235
16
58 持続可能な開発を目指す ~ ドメイン・ユースケース駆動(クリーンアーキテクチャ) + 単方向に制限した処理 + FRP kondei 15/01/04
15/04/16
1393
6
59 ドメイン駆動設計の比類なきパワーでRailsレガシーコードなど大爆殺したるわあああ!!! MinoDriven 19/12/12
20/12/07
548
10
60 ご主人様、小難しいDDDやクリーンアーキテクチャはお忘れになって、”削除しやすい設計”から始められてはいかが? mejileben 20/07/14
21/02/18
654
9
61 PlantUML で ER 図(ERD)を描く(似非ではないです) Tachy_Pochy 17/07/27
18/05/09
417
19
62 テーブル設計を遅らせることでユーザー体験の最大化を狙える!?米国式最新開発手法「ADD」とは。。 masaki_u 20/10/23
20/10/26
483
2
63 業務でWebサービス開発をする際に気をつけたいこと(新卒向け) zaru 16/12/24
17/07/03
1767
9
64 DDDで設計するならCQRSの利用を検討すべき ledmonster 14/12/28
15/11/02
734
12
65 「Controller にビジネスロジックを書くな」の対応パターン os1ma 20/11/30
21/05/23
87
51
66 アーキテクチャの「なぜ?」を記録する!ADRってなんぞや? fuubit 19/05/20
19/05/23
239
16
67 Rails:Service層を運用して良かったところ、悪かったところ joooee0000 16/01/28
18/05/25
614
16
68 牛乳卵問題に学ぶ、`要望` と `要件定義` と `設計` と `実装` の違い taruhachi 19/03/04
19/03/04
868
22
69 要求定義と要件定義の違いを考える sunstripe2011 16/11/02
21/04/16
265
15
70 エンジニアのためのsalesforce超入門 tarokamikaze 17/03/01
17/08/03
289
11
71 【新人教育 資料】第1章 UMLまでの道 〜オブジェクト指向編〜 devopsCoordinator 16/01/28
19/04/25
571
11
72 マリオカートのER図について考える assu_mz 19/11/01
21/05/28
689
2
73 プログラムの依存関係とモジュール構成のこと wm3 16/05/09
19/09/26
387
7
74 今すぐ「レイヤードアーキテクチャ+DDD」を理解しよう。(golang) tono-maron 19/10/31
20/08/23
212
14
75 Rubyで学ぶ1年目に知っておきたいプログラミング技法8選 aki202 19/09/01
21/02/12
307
1
76 【新人教育 資料】第3章 UMLまでの道 〜図種類紹介とクラス図の解説編〜 devopsCoordinator 16/02/01
19/04/25
311
16
77 大規模Webアプリケーションにおける複雑性とアーキテクチャ設計に関する一考察 tmknom 16/12/20
18/08/11
761
9
78 【コードで分かるUMLシリーズ】クラス図の書きかた(集約とコンポジションの意味の違い) azuki8 17/08/15
21/05/15
236
10
79 awsって最近すごいらしいね?あれいくらで作れる?を雑に見積もる otupy 20/06/12
20/06/12
666
3
80 AWS 認定 Associate level を大体一ヶ月で取った話 yutachaos 17/08/24
19/05/09
474
4
81 ドメインモデルとは(「現場で役立つシステム設計の原則」より) jimpei 19/11/04
19/11/06
329
9
82 Clean Architecture の勘所は『鎖国』だ。 t2-kob 20/04/29
20/04/29
366
5
83 オニオンアーキテクチャとは何か cocoa-maemae 19/12/31
21/05/19
70
23
84 Web API 設計の基本を学ぶ(APIエンドポイント) Amtkxa 19/01/13
19/01/13
126
12
85 猿には分からないけど、非エンジニアでも分かると思う、ドメイン駆動設計の「ド」の字くらいだけ説明する ryoya1122 20/06/23
20/06/23
477
1
86 リレーションシップ駆動要件分析(RDRA) tatane616 19/05/19
19/05/19
211
8
87 「設計なんて不要でしょ」について kahirokunn 19/04/29
19/05/04
1015
2
88 デメテルの法則を厳密に守るにはどうすればいいの? br_branch 19/06/20
19/06/20
117
10
89 mermaid.js で上流工程を好きになろう caesar_cat 19/12/06
19/12/06
106
12
90 [python] クラス図を自動生成する kenichi-hamaguchi 19/05/02
19/06/13
227
13
91 明日から使えるDDDのためのユースケース駆動開発(ICONIXプロセス) hirodragon 20/05/06
21/03/15
274
5
92 Webアプリケーションの構成に関する予備知識 okeyaki 14/03/08
14/04/27
779
10
93 ゲームで学ぶ「役に立つ」ドメインモデルの考え方 MinoDriven 20/04/19
20/12/07
451
3
94 基本/詳細設計って呼び方やめませんか garbagetown 16/12/14
16/12/17
492
5
95 PlantUMLをMac OS Xで使う kohashi 17/02/15
20/10/09
195
9
96 達人に学ぶDB設計 | 正規化と非正規化、インデックスについて k_kind 20/06/22
20/06/27
295
8
97 [DDD]ドメイン駆動設計の定義についてEric Evansはなんと言っているのか little_hand_s 17/09/26
20/02/17
312
8
98 ドメイン駆動設計で貧乏を爆殺する MinoDriven 19/12/19
19/12/29
481
6
99 もう辛くない!テキストで書くUML クラス図編 ykawakami 17/06/06
17/06/06
224
4
100 【開発初心者向け】Webアプリケーションの設計手順(企画~テストまで) takahirocook 21/01/14
21/01/14
52
26

  1. 1行目が総数。2行目が直近3ヵ月。 

0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up